티스토리 뷰

IT/DATABASE

오라클 시퀀스

김보야 2016. 5. 13. 17:50

옵션

START WITH 1

 //시작값

INCREMENT BY 1

 //증가값

MAXVALUE 999999

 //최대값

MINVALUE 1

 //최소값

NOCYCLE  

 //순환지정

NOCACHE 

 //캐시지정


 

 


시퀀스 생성

1
CREATE SEQUENCE 시퀀스명 (옵션);
cs

    


시퀀스 수정

1
ALTER SEQUENCE 시퀀스명 (옵션);
cs

 


시퀀스 삭제

1
DROP SEQUENCE 시퀀스명;
cs


 

시퀀스 조회

1
SELECT * FROM USER_SEQUENCES;
cs


 

현재 시퀀스 조회

1
SELECT 시퀀스명.CURRVAL FROM DUAL;
cs


 

 



Q. 기존 등록되어 있는 시퀀스에서 시작값을 1000증가 시켜라

1
2
3
ALTER SEQUENCE 시퀀스명 increment BY 1000;
SELECT 시퀀스명.nextval from dual;
ALTER SEQUENCE 시퀀스명 increment by 1;
cs


댓글
공지사항
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크
TAG
more
«   2025/01   »
1 2 3 4
5 6 7 8 9 10 11
12 13 14 15 16 17 18
19 20 21 22 23 24 25
26 27 28 29 30 31
글 보관함